我做了一个小的代码,不发送任何电子邮件。它给了我空白页。有什么建议么?

<?php
$result_array1 = array();
$result_array2 = array();
$result_array3 = array();
$result_array4 = array();
$sql1 = "SELECT * FROM  `test_thing`";
$result1 = mysql_query("$sql1") or die($sql1.mysql_error());
while($row1 = mysql_fetch_array($result1))
{
   $result_array1[] = $row1['email'];
   $result_array2[] = $subject;
   $result_array3[] = $message;
   $result_array4[] = $header;
}
$sentmail = mail($result_array1,$result_array2,$result_array3,$result_array4);
?>

最佳答案

It gives me a blank page.


其实应该。您不会在显示的代码中使用输出函数。如果希望收到错误消息,请确保已启用display_errors并将error_reporting设置为E_ALL

10-08 09:44